Re: Blank admin page after update to 2.4.5
  • 2010/10/31 20:27

  • altabear

  • Just popping in

  • Posts: 27

  • Since: 2009/10/10


Solved!

I downloaded Xoops Protector from the modules directory, just to check it, and it had more files in the www/modules/protector directory than the one in the upgrade package has. Deleted both the root folder and the xoops_lib/modules/protector one.

Copied the new ones and it works!

Thanks for the help. : )
